Zazi Maidan District (Pashto: ځاځي ميدان ولسوالۍ, Persian: ولسوالی زازی میدان), or Jaji Maidan or Dzadzi Maidan, is located in the northeastern part of Khost Province, Afghanistan. It borders Bak District to the west, Paktia Province to the north and Pakistan to the north and east. The population is 21,400 (2006). The district center is the village of Zazi Maidan, situated in the eastern part of the district.
